Home
last modified time | relevance | path

Searched refs:file_symtab (Results 1 – 4 of 4) sorted by relevance

/illumos-gate/usr/src/lib/libproc/common/
H A DPsymtab.c267 if (fptr->file_symtab.sym_elf) { in file_info_free()
268 (void) elf_end(fptr->file_symtab.sym_elf); in file_info_free()
269 free(fptr->file_symtab.sym_elfmem); in file_info_free()
271 if (fptr->file_symtab.sym_byname) in file_info_free()
272 free(fptr->file_symtab.sym_byname); in file_info_free()
273 if (fptr->file_symtab.sym_byaddr) in file_info_free()
274 free(fptr->file_symtab.sym_byaddr); in file_info_free()
760 symp = fptr->file_ctf_dyn ? &fptr->file_dynsym : &fptr->file_symtab; in Pbuild_file_ctf()
1751 fptr->file_symtab.sym_data_pri = symdata; in build_alt_debug()
1752 fptr->file_symtab.sym_symn += symshdr.sh_size / symshdr.sh_entsize; in build_alt_debug()
[all …]
H A DPcore.c1506 if (fp->file_symtab.sym_data_pri != NULL) { in fake_up_symtab()
1570 fp->file_symtab.sym_elf = elf_memory((char *)b, size); in fake_up_symtab()
1571 if (fp->file_symtab.sym_elf == NULL) { in fake_up_symtab()
1576 fp->file_symtab.sym_elfmem = b; in fake_up_symtab()
1634 fp->file_symtab.sym_elf = elf_memory((char *)b, size); in fake_up_symtab()
1635 if (fp->file_symtab.sym_elf == NULL) { in fake_up_symtab()
1640 fp->file_symtab.sym_elfmem = b; in fake_up_symtab()
1644 if ((scn = elf_getscn(fp->file_symtab.sym_elf, 1)) == NULL || in fake_up_symtab()
1645 (fp->file_symtab.sym_data_pri = elf_getdata(scn, NULL)) == NULL || in fake_up_symtab()
1646 (scn = elf_getscn(fp->file_symtab.sym_elf, 2)) == NULL || in fake_up_symtab()
[all …]
H A DPgcore.c620 sym = &fptr->file_symtab; in count_sections()
630 fptr->file_symtab.sym_data_pri != NULL && in count_sections()
631 fptr->file_symtab.sym_symn != 0 && in count_sections()
632 fptr->file_symtab.sym_strs != NULL) { in count_sections()
702 sym_tbl_t *sym = dynsym ? &fptr->file_dynsym : &fptr->file_symtab; in dump_symtab()
814 sym = &fptr->file_symtab; in dump_sections()
846 fptr->file_symtab.sym_data_pri != NULL && in dump_sections()
847 fptr->file_symtab.sym_symn != 0 && in dump_sections()
848 fptr->file_symtab.sym_strs != NULL) { in dump_sections()
H A DPcontrol.h116 sym_tbl_t file_symtab; /* symbol table */ member